Let us begin by looking back at the band’s activities at the time and revisiting the era that gave birth to this controversial record. 1995 “KISS MY ASS Tour” – Jan 24–Feb 13: Japan #1 / Oceania #1 (17 shows); June 16–Aug 9: North America #1 (26 shows) ← *Official KISS *Unplugged* / Nov: Production of *Carnival of Souls* begins; Dec 15: Hollywood show. 1996 (*Jan: *Carnival of Souls* completed*) “Alive/Worldwide Tour” – June 15–Nov 10: North America #2 (89 shows + 1 MOR show); Nov 20–Dec 21: Europe #1 (19 shows); Dec 28–31: North America #3 (4 shows). 1997 – Jan 18–Feb 15: Japan #2 / Oceania #2 (15 shows); Mar 7–May 6: Central & South America / North America #3 (40 shows); May 16–July 5: Europe #2 (23 shows) (*Oct 28: *Carnival of Souls* released*). This covers the 1995–1997 era of KISS. The *Carnival of Souls* sessions began in November 1995 and were completed in late January 1996. However, this was a truly peculiar period for the band; while they were striving to create a powerful follow-up to *Revenge*, they already had one foot in the door of the impending reunion, and consequently, this became the final album featuring the Bruce Kulick/Eric Singer lineup. While this release presents the tracks in their original source order, here we will categorize and introduce them by session and intended album for clarity. Early Sessions Retaining the *Revenge* Vibe (2 songs, 3 takes) – Tracks 1-2: “I Wanna Rule The World” (2 takes). The first three takes on this disc come from the earliest phase of the sessions that ultimately did not make the *Carnival of Souls* album. “I Wanna Rule The World” is a song that would resurface during the 1998 *Psycho Circus* sessions. While “I Wanna Rule The World #2” already embodies the *Carnival of Souls* style, “Take #1” feels more like a continuation of the atmosphere found in the previous *Revenge* or *Hot in the Shade* sessions. Track 3: “Juliet.” “Juliet” is another song that feels like an extension of the *Revenge* era; it was never re-recorded after this point. Main Sessions: *Psycho Circus*-Related Songs (3 songs, 4 takes) – Track 4: “Carnival Intro.” Tracks 4 onwards belong to the main *Carnival of Souls* sessions (November 1995 – January 1996). The opening “Carnival Intro” was originally intended as the album intro for *Carnival of Souls* and was later reused for *Psycho Circus*. Tracks 12/14: “Rain” (2 takes). Although “Rain” was included on *Carnival of Souls*, it was originally a remake of an unfinished song titled “Rain Keeps Falling” from the *Hot in the Shade* sessions. During these sessions, it was reworked into a heavier track titled “Rain” and included on the album, but it later followed a curious path, reverting to its original version and lyrics during the *Psycho Circus* sessions. Track 13: “Within.” “Within” is another song that crossed over into the *Psycho Circus* era. Although completed during the *Carnival of Souls* sessions, the material ultimately found its home on the *Psycho Circus* album three years later. Main Sessions: Alternate versions of *Carnival of Souls* tracks (6 songs). Track 8: “I Walk Alone” – A standout track known as Bruce Kulick’s vocal debut; this release features the original version with Gene Simmons on lead vocals. Tracks 9–11: “Seduction of the Innocent” / “Childhood’s End” / “Hate”; Tracks 16/17: “I Confess” / “In My Head” – These are raw rough takes and alternate versions of songs included on the album. “Childhood’s End,” in particular, is a rare version featuring completely different lyrics from the original. Main Sessions: Unreleased tracks (4 songs, 5 takes). Track 5: “I Wanna Live” – Co-written by Gene Simmons and Vinnie Vincent; a song originating from the pre-*Revenge* era that resurfaced during the *Carnival of Souls* sessions. Tracks 6/7: “Carnival of Souls” (2 takes) – The album’s title track, which was inexplicably left off the final release; here, you can enjoy two different takes. Track 15: “Hey You” – An unreleased song by Gene Simmons. Track 18: “Outromental” – An instrumental number composed by Bruce Kulick that was originally intended to close the album; it was ultimately shelved and replaced by “I Walk Alone” (featuring Bruce on vocals). *Carnival of Souls* stands as one of KISS’s most unique albums—a bold shift toward the grunge era that occurred amidst the frenzy of the band’s reunion.
